The embrittling effects of silicon make it difficult to produce silicon steels with more than about 3 wt.% silicon. The silicon steels are produced in two forms, highly textured grain-oriented alloys and alloys in which the grains are not oriented. Grain orientation is carried out to align the magnetic easy axis. Baosteel CRGO B23r090 Laser Scribed Silicon Steel Laser scribing is widely used to reduce core loss of grain-oriented silicon steel recently. The effect of stress annealing treatment on laser scribing product has been analyzed. It was found that as laser power increased, the core loss reduced and the damage to surface coating exacerbated.
